As discussed at [1] the __nocache_fix() macro in sparc's SRMMU can be made type safe and so the compiler will yell anout misuse of pXd pointers for which the __nocache_fix() is primarily used.
The first patch is an fix of such misuse that I've discovered after adding type cast to __nocache_fix(), but to avoid breaking bisection I've made it the first commit.
